HENRI WEDIER : revenue, balance sheet and financial ratios

HENRI WEDIER is a French company founded 21 years ago, specialized in the sector Conseil pour les affaires et autres conseils de gestion. Based in SAINT-MARTIN-BOULOGNE (62280), this company of category PME shows in 2017 a revenue of 1.6 M€. Financial history - HENRI WEDIER (SIREN 480316116)
Indicator 2021 2020 2019 2017 2016
Revenue N/C N/C N/C 1 578 181 € 1 059 665 €
Net income -419 079 € -252 664 € 61 715 € 43 082 € 110 672 €
EBITDA N/C N/C N/C 142 811 € 200 825 €
Net margin N/C N/C N/C 2.7% 10.4%
